1. Grinder Type

When it comes to spice coffee grinders, there are typically two main types: blade grinders and burr grinders. Blade grinders use rotating blades to chop up the spices or coffee beans, and they are generally more affordable and easier to find. However, they often result in uneven grinds, which can affect the flavor profile of your coffee or spices. On the other hand, burr grinders utilize two revolving surfaces to crush the beans or spices consistently, yielding a more uniform grind, which is particularly important if precision is what you seek.

If you regularly grind spices alongside coffee, considering a grinder with dual capabilities or interchangeable attachments can also be beneficial. Some grinders are designed specifically for spices, featuring tighter tolerances that offer more control over the grind size. Understanding the differences between these types will significantly influence the quality of your ground products.

3. Material and Durability

The materials used in the construction of a spice coffee grinder play a significant role in its performance and longevity. Most grinders have either stainless steel or ceramic grinding mechanisms. Stainless steel blades tend to be more durable and resistant to wear, making them ideal for tougher spices like nutmeg or dried garlic. Conversely, ceramic burrs are excellent for producing an even grind and are less prone to overheating, but they can be more fragile and susceptible to chipping.

In addition to the grinding components, consider the overall build of the grinder, including the housing and any other parts. A well-built grinder will not only stand the test of time but will also provide a better user experience. Seek out products with solid customer reviews focusing on durability and performance. Investing in a high-quality grinder is worthwhile if you’re serious about elevating your cooking.

Can I use the same grinder for both coffee and spices?

While it is possible to use the same grinder for both coffee and spices, it is generally recommended to have separate grinders for each to prevent flavor cross-contamination. Spices can leave oils and residues in the grinder that may affect the taste of coffee, and conversely, the strong flavors of coffee might alter the taste of your spices. Therefore, if you grind spices frequently, consider using a dedicated spice grinder to maintain the purity of both flavors.

If you choose to use one grinder for both, be sure to clean it thoroughly between uses. This entails removing any leftover spice or coffee residue and possibly running a small batch of neutral grains, like rice, to absorb any lingering flavors or oils. Regular cleaning will help ensure that each grind maintains its intended taste, but please remember that investing in two separate grinders may provide the best results in the long run.

How do I clean my spice coffee grinder?

Cleaning your spice coffee grinder is crucial for maintaining its performance and ensuring that flavors do not mix. First, unplug the unit and remove any components that can be detached, such as the bowl or lid. For most grinders, you can wipe the interior with a dry cloth or brush to remove leftover coffee or spice particles. If there are stubborn residues, using a small amount of rice or dedicated grinder cleaning pellets can help absorb oils and odors left behind.

For deeper cleaning, particularly for electric grinders, you may also consider using a damp cloth for the exterior and a brush for crevices. Avoid using water inside the grinder, as moisture can damage the electrical components. Always refer to the manufacturer’s guidelines for specific cleaning instructions tailored to your model and ensure it is completely dry before putting it back together and using it again.

What are the advantages of a burr grinder over a blade grinder?

Burr grinders offer several advantages over blade grinders, particularly in terms of grind consistency and precision. With burr grinders, coffee beans and spices are crushed between two abrasive surfaces, allowing for a uniform grind size that enhances flavor extraction. This consistency is crucial for coffee brewing methods like pour-over or espresso, where the grind size significantly impacts the taste. Blade grinders, in contrast, can produce a mix of coarse and fine particles since they chop rather than grind, which can lead to uneven flavor profiles.

In addition to consistent grind sizes, burr grinders typically allow for more precise control over the fineness of the grind. Many models come with adjustable settings, giving you the flexibility to grind from coarse for French press to fine for espresso. Moreover, burr grinders tend to produce less heat during grinding, which helps preserve essential oils in coffee beans and spices that can be lost with excessive heat. Ultimately, if quality and versatility are your focus, a burr grinder is a worthwhile investment.

What is the price range for quality spice coffee grinders?

The price range for quality spice coffee grinders varies widely based on type, brand, and features. Typically, blade grinders can be found starting around $20 and can go up to $50 for more advanced models with additional functionality. While they may be more budget-friendly, they often lack the precision and grind consistency offered by higher-end options. However, they are still suitable for casual users who grind infrequently or in smaller quantities.

When it comes to burr grinders, you can expect to pay anywhere from $50 to several hundred dollars. Entry-level burr grinders start in the $50 to $100 range, while more professional-grade models may cost between $100 and $300. High-end burr grinders with advanced features and superior build quality can exceed $300. Ultimately, it’s essential to consider how often you will use the grinder and what features are most important to you, as this will help determine the best investment for your needs.
